Kerala rights of Vijay’s ‘Mersal’ sold for record price of Rs 7 crore

Written by : TNM

Vijay’s Mersal is gearing up for a big release this Diwali. Coming after the mega success of Theri, this second-time collaboration from Vijay and Atlee has made all the right noise so far. With the film’s theatrical rights being sold for record prices across regions, its Kerala theatrical rights have been snapped up for a whopping Rs. 7 crore, making it the biggest buy for a Vijay starrer.

In the film, Vijay will appear in three different roles — a panchayat head, a doctor and a magician. The actor’s comic timing will be brought on screen through the magician’s role. His portions are intended to evoke laughter and lighten up the mood, according to reliable sources. As the Panchayat head, sporting a twirled moustache, Vijay will be seen in the period portion. Those portions were completed in Chennai and Rajasthan. It’s set in the 80s with a rural backdrop.

Nithya Menen essays his pair in the retro portion. It’s for the first time in his career Vijay will be seen playing triple roles including that of a father and two sons. The film, currently in its post-production stage, was shot across various exotic locations in Europe in a month-long schedule.

Being bankrolled by Sri Thenandal Studios, Mersal has music by AR Rahman and it is believed to be the most expensive film for the makers. The film also stars actor-filmmaker SJ Suryah as an antagonist, apart from Kajal Aggarwal and Samantha Ruth Prabhu in key roles.
